Programování v Ninjatrader

Mám otázku ohladom porgramovanie v NinjaTrader. Vieťe poradiť ako v ninjatraderovi naprogramovať respektíve uložiť hodnotu minima a maxima určitej sviečky definovanej časom, to znamená high a low hodinovej sviečky napr. o 14,00 hod, a túto hodnotu uchovať počas celého obchodného dňa?
Roman Dvořák Odpověděl:Roman Dvořák

#region Variables
private double range_low = 99999999;
private double range_high = 0;

protected override void Initialize()
{

if ( ToTime(Time[0]) == 140000) {range_low = 99999999; range_high = 0; };
if ( ( ToTime(Time[0]) >= 140000) && ( ToTime(Time[0]) <= 150000) )
{ range_low = Math.Min(range_low, Low[0]);
range_high = Math.Max(range_high, High[0]);
};

}

Štítky:ninjatrader
Abyste mohli položit dotaz, je třeba se přihlásit nebo zaregistrovat.
Nejnovější dotazy
  • „Dobrý den. Jak to funfuje v LTA když mám účet u IB ale nemám ninjatrader a nevyužiju tak vaše indikátory? MOžná by…“
  • „Dobrý deň, nedávno som si kúpil knihu MarketProfile - ESO v ruce obchodníka a mal by som záujem o zakúpenie vašich…“
  • „Dobrý den. Mám u Vás zakoupenu licenci MPP bez vizualizace Div delta. Dá se nastavit zasílání alertů e-mailem taky v…“
Nejoblíbenější dotazy
  • „Zdravím, které futures a forex trhy je možné s vámi v rámci LTA obchodovat intradenně a které futures swingově ? Kolik…“
  • „Dobrý den, chci začít studovat trading. Chtěl jsem se zeptat od jaké knihy na vašim webu bych měl začít a nebo jestli…“
  • „Dobrý den, jak nahlížíte na intradenní trading přes mobilní telefon. Je možné vytvářet konzistentně zisk? Děkuji…“
Menu Zavřít